My pay is higher than what is considered the norm in the Philippines for fresh graduates and newly licensed engineers. Also, I enjoy a 13th-month pay and bonus despite being with the company for less than a year.

It is very decent but of course, I wouldnt complain if it was higher. It is difficult to work so far from my permanent home and live far from the city so that travel time can be less. The work is very demanding of the body as well so there are added costs for medicine and health maintenance. The bonus is based on performance but it is very hard to control as there are a lot of groups that affect the overall performance of the plant and you can only do so much on your shifts but you cannot controll how the other groups perform.

The compensation is exceptionally good for an entry-level position. Additionally, there are benefits such as performance-based bonuses, a rice allowance, and transportation services, with more to look forward to upon regularization.
